Key Features of Modernized Cruises
1. High-Tech Amenities
- Smart Cabins: Many ships now feature smart cabins with touchpad controls for lighting, temperature, and room service.
- Fast Wi-Fi: Modern cruises boast fast and reliable internet access, allowing travelers to stay connected at sea.
- Robotic Bartenders: Some cruise lines, like Royal Caribbean, have introduced robotic bartenders to deliver unique cocktails.

6. Sustainability Measures
Cruise lines are stepping up efforts to protect the environment. Key initiatives include:
- Hybrid Engines: Ships powered by liquefied natural gas (LNG) and hybrid systems reduce emissions.
- Elimination of Single-Use Plastics: Many cruise lines have banned plastic straws, cups, and utensils.
- Marine Conservation Programs: Partnerships with organizations promote ocean health and marine wildlife protection.
Popular Cruise Lines Leading Modernization
Royal Caribbean International
Known for its cutting-edge ships, Royal Caribbean offers unique experiences like skydiving simulators, robotic bartenders, and the largest cruise ships in the world.Norwegian Cruise Line
Norwegian focuses on freestyle cruising, giving passengers the flexibility to dine and explore at their own pace. Their ships feature luxury suites, water parks, and Broadway-style shows.Carnival Cruise Line
Carnival offers affordable options with a focus on fun and family-friendly activities, such as waterslides, mini-golf, and themed parties.Celebrity Cruises
Celebrity stands out for its luxury ships, culinary excellence, and commitment to sustainability.Viking Ocean Cruises
Viking specializes in smaller, intimate ships with destination-focused itineraries, cultural enrichment programs, and eco-friendly practices.
